While you were not active on the network, your friends, family, or colleagues might have tried to reach you but could not get through. Airtel Thanks App now smartly alerts you for these calls you missed through a quick notification.
Similarly, you might have tried to call a friend, family member or colleague but they were out of network. Airtel Thanks App now sends you alert to inform you once they are back in network, so that you can connect with them.
You will get a notification on your mobile once you are back in network or the person you were trying to reach is back in network. You can track all these notifications in real-time on your Thanks App.
You can view a list of these missed calls on Thanks App in a single click. Just go to
Manage tab > missed call alerts
You or the person you were trying to reach may miss calls because of any of the following reasons:
- Phone’s battery gets discharged
- Taking a flight
- Phone is switched off
- Vacationing in a remote location with fluctuating network

All Airtel Black, Prepaid and Postpaid customers can enable this service.
If you are already subscribed to these alerts via SMS, you do not need to change any settings in Thanks app. You can smartly access all your alerts on a single screen in the Airtel Thanks app.
For Thanks app to show you the list of callers as per your contact list, we will need your permission to access contacts. Rest assured that your privacy is our concern, and we do not collect or save this data in any form. You can still view the numbers from which you received these calls without providing this permission.
Airtel’s smart network keeps track of calls that did not get through due to any reason. This smart network forwards these alerts once you or the person you are trying to reach is back in network.
Absolutely! You can always go to Thanks App > Account > Settings to enable or disable these alerts.
